General description

Carbamazepine-10,11-epoxide is the primary, active metabolite in both urine and serum of carbamazepine, an anticonvulsant drug used in the treatment of epilepsy and bipolar disorder as well as trigeminal neuralgia. Potential toxicity of the epoxide metabolite requires regular therapeutic drug monitoring by LC or LC/MS for patients taking carbamazepine.
